Irana Kerimova was born in Baku. She studied at school №141 in Baku and later attended Baku Choreography Academy. She is now a member of Theatre of Musical Comedy, where she works as an actress. As a child, her main hobby was dancing. Her first dance teacher was famous Azerbaijani dancer Zeynal Jigarkhanov and then Jamila Bayramova, who contributed to Irana's acceptance into the dance group of Khazar University. One year later, after being actively involved in this dance group, Irana participated at her first role in the musical Layla, Majnun and Love directed by Sabina Ismailzade. Her acting career started after that. She starred in the film "The Cold Sun" directed by Sadaqat Kerimova, which was scheduled to premiere on March 16, 2020, but was postponed due to the coronavirus pandemic. She received several offers to star in 3 upcoming Azerbaijani documentary films.
